Larkin Launches New Recycling Initiative

Today, as a school community we officially launched an exciting new recycling project in partnership with Sunflower Recycling, marking another positive step towards sustainability within our school community.

The initiative is the result of months of behind the scenes work involving Sunflower Recycling, along with our dedicated staff and students, to ensure the project was ready to roll out successfully. Funding support for the project was generously provided by Olivia Brody from the NEIC, helping to bring this important initiative to life.

The launch event was supported by Dublin Lord Mayor Ray McAdam and Green Party Councillor Janet Horner, whose involvement highlighted the wider community’s commitment to environmental responsibility.

Special thanks also go to Cara and Reyne for producing a fantastic promotional video, along with the staff and students who participated. This video encourages everyone at Larkin to recycle correctly and make full use of the waste stations located throughout the school building.
